Roger W. Smith is the leading contemporary practitioner of the English watchmaking tradition associated with George Daniels. Working from the Isle of Man, Smith and his atelier construct watches according to the Daniels Method, emphasizing the ability to create the principal components within a closely integrated workshop. rwsmithwatches.com
